Teamxbox : Stormrise Review

Teamxbox report's: On a certain level, the new real-time strategy from publisher Sega and developer Creative Assembly is brilliant. But brilliant in that way that Einstein or Richard Feynman are-in a way that I and most regular people can't comprehend in the least. It's brilliant in the sense that someone came up with a truly original approach to the RTS genre for consoles.

